Keep in mind that Winamp 5.8 is an official release but not actually stable and as such is not supported by Radionomy, thus, it is riddled with numerous bugs and may lead to unforeseen software crashes. Replaced: MPEG-4 Pt.2 Decoder now using Media Foundation (Vista and higher).Replaced: H.264 Decoder now using Media Foundation (Vista and higher).Replaced: AAC Decoder now using Media Foundation (Vista and higher).Replaced: MP3 Decoder now mpg123 based (instead of Fraunhofer).Replaced: CD playback and ripping now using native Windows API (instead of Sonic).Removed: gen_jumpex & UnicodeTaskbarFix (making way for native implementations).Removed: All former "Pro" licensed functions (Winamp is now 100% freeware again).Misc: MP3 Encoder must now be downloaded manually (to Shared folder).Misc: Moved shared DLLs to Winamp\Shared folder.Misc: More general tweaks, improvements, fixes and optimizations.Misc: Minimum required OS is now Win XP sp3 (Windows 7 or higher recommended).Fixed: Crash on load if jnetlib was not correctly initialized.Fixed: Divide-by-zero crash with badly formed files (thanks ITDefensor).Fixed: Not showing correct current icon pack in preferences.Fixed: New URLs not being remembered after using Reset history in Open URL dialog.Improved: Added a Playlist Search feature (thanks Victor).
